Join us for an intimate conversation with Frank-Paul Santangelo, the former MLB utility player who transformed into one of baseball’s most relatable broadcasters. In this episode, F.P. shares his remarkable journey from being drafted in the 20th round by the Montreal Expos to carving out a seven-year major league career and eventually finding his voice in the broadcast booth. We explore his deep connection to the Nationals organization, his philosophy on baseball commentary, and why he chose to put down roots in Alexandria after years of constant movement. F.P. reveals the challenges of maintaining relationships during the grueling baseball season and why, despite the sacrifices, he considers the ballpark his “happy place.” Whether you’re a longtime Nationals fan or simply appreciate authentic baseball stories, this conversation offers rare insights into the life of a true baseball lifer.

🏆 About F.P. Santangelo:

Frank-Paul Santangelo played seven seasons in Major League Baseball (1995-2001) with the Montreal Expos, San Francisco Giants, Los Angeles Dodgers, and Oakland Athletics. After his playing career, he became a beloved broadcaster, spending eight seasons as the color analyst for the Washington Nationals on MASN, and later working with the San Francisco Giants.
